This text message conversation, between Lauren Sado and Gabby Mosley, is a conversation in which Lauren and Gabby discuss an event.

The submitter provided the following about the artifact’s history:
This is a screenshot of a group message between myself and my two freshman roommates. The messages are all blue since it is a group text using iMessage. The messages shown are only between me and one of the roommates as the other roommate was in class when I sent the original message. I sent a text in our group text we started freshman year when we all shared a dorm. I texted my old roommates because I was at the President’s Ice Cream Social and I was asking if either of them were there too. That got us to talk about how we missed seeing each other every day and attending the on campus events together.
